Meteorin-like Levels in Individuals With Periodontitis

Detailed Description

Periodontitis is a destructive chronic inflammatory disease that can start with localized inflammatory reactions created by the supporting tissues surrounding the teeth against microorganisms and then result in loss of teeth. Cytokines play an important role in inflammation that occurs in periodontal disease.

Interleukine -1β ( IL-1β ) levels are associated with periodontal destruction in the pathogenesis of periodontal disease. Cytokines such as Interleukine-10 (IL-10) and transforming growth factor- β (TGF-β) have been reported to decrease periodontal disease progression rate.

Gingival crevicular fluid shows the cellular response in the periodontium. The most important host-related ingredients are inflammatory markers, including cytokines, enzymes, and interleukins. Saliva analysis is used in the diagnosis of systemic conditions as well as in the diagnosis of oral pathologies.

Meteorin- like (Metrnl) is a protein that plays a role in natural and acquired immune-related functions and inflammatory responses, and expressed in barrier tissues (skin and mucosa) as well as various macrophage populations, from dendritic cells and some granulocytes. Metrnl has proven to be an inflammatory-related immunoregulatory cytokine and shown to play a role in the pathogenesis of human inflammatory diseases. Metrnl, which is highly expressed from the oral mucosa to the esophagus, may play a role in the onset of periodontitis and an effective marker in preventing the progression of destruction. We think that Metrnl plays an important role in periodontitis, an inflammatory disease. The aim of this study is to compare the Metrnl, IL-1β, and IL-10 levels of healthy and periodontitis individuals

Inclusion Criteria
  • systemically healthy
  • individuals who does not have a disease under treatment,
  • individuals without regular systemic medication
Exclusion Criteria
  • smoking
  • receiving periodontal treatment in the last 6 months
  • pregnancy
  • menopausal or menstrual period
